Bad weather, UV light, and dirt have nothing on retractable doors even in storage.īut there are a few problems with it. They can easily be rolled up and stored in the same position. This will keep them in business for decades on end. You can remove them and store them in the winter when you don’t need to block the sun and its heat. You can even get a retractable door custom made while traditional screen doors come in only a few sizes. They create a tight seal when in use and keep insects from flying into the house or crawling through the cracks around the border. In fact, they are said to outlast traditional (even if expensive) screen doors. These doors are also made of durable materials that help avoid wear and tear due to the act of slamming them shut. Retractable doors are easy to use and not at all obstructive, especially if you’re walking in and out with goods in your hands.

If you have a great view, you also don’t have to compromise looking out at the vista. These doors allow you to keep your opaque doors open and allow the right amount of sunlight and fresh air into your home while keeping yourself insulated from the heat. They're a great addition to spaces with tropical weather for this reason. For instance, you can buy retractable doors that are designed to reduce glare and heat from the sun. Retractable doors usually have a very clean look and come in many varieties. Since it's retractable, you can roll it up and get it out of the way when you don’t need it.
